    After setting out on foot to find breakfast, this was pretty much the only place open on Memorial day. It appeared to be more of a bakery than cafe, but they do both very well. The interior is set up like an old farm house kitchen, including beverages and place settings being self serve. I ordered the breakfast burrito smothered in homemade green chile and was not disappointed. Servings are large and filling, even the people next to me had a very large plate of eggs Benedict and hash browns. If you don't get filled up, there is always the fresh baked pastries and pies filling the cases.

    so i was a little afraid of what to expect when we went inside to $9 breakfasts and self serve sitting. the meals size and quality is totally worth the price with delicious french toast and syrup, perfect hash browns (i am kind of particular with my hashbrowns and most places can't cook them right), and a visually unappealing but so very tasty sausage patty (it looked like an over cooked hamburger patty). My picky daughter ate most of the plate we placed together for her. definitely give it a go. PS the bakery looked amazing with its cream cheese danishes, apple turnovers, and sticky buns.

    Traveling for work, I couldn't eat one more hotel breakfast. I stumbled across this Mom & Pop shop and decided to give it a try. Sadly, I'm doing the gluten-free thing so I could dive into any of their pastries. The case looks AMAZING! But I did get to enjoy a nice cup of hot tea and a skillet full of fresh veggies. It's all very serve-yourself including tables and silverware. For business travelers, they do not accept American Express and the itemized receipt is hand written. I would have like my eggs to be more over easy than medium, and would have loved more of their green chili. But over all, a definite recommendation!
